GX-1 GOOD GAME FLASK - SUPERIOR EXAMPLE!

 

ITEM 6869. STAG / "GOOD / GAME" - WILLOW TREE, (McK# GX-1), aquamarine, pontil scar, pint, sheared and fire polished mouth, mint. American, 1830-1850, scarce.

Although it is not documented as such it is likely that this flask was blown at the Coffin and Hay Glass Works in Southern New Jersey. Unlike other flasks blown in this mold, this top shelf example boasts superb mold detailing and crisply defined lettering. There is no high point wear and no damage.
